码迷,mamicode.com
首页 > 编程语言
Java中的五种单例模式实现方法
[代码] Java中的五种单例模式实现方法 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686...
分类:编程语言   时间:2015-07-19 01:18:56    阅读次数:194
黑马程序员——java高新---JDK1.5新特性和反射
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------一、JDK1.5新特性 ——>静态导入 import和import static之间的区别: 1、import是导入一个类或某个包中所有的类。 2、import static是导入一...
分类:编程语言   时间:2015-07-19 01:16:57    阅读次数:165
[LeetCode][JavaScript]Wildcard Matching
Wildcard MatchingImplement wildcard pattern matching with support for'?'and'*'.'?' Matches any single character.'*' Matches any sequence of characters...
分类:编程语言   时间:2015-07-19 01:18:52    阅读次数:208
走进Python世界(三)变量与运算符
变量 python中的变量和其他语言的变量类似,它是一个可变化的量,存储规定范围的值。 深一层次的说,它其实是一种引用,引用了存在计算机内存某一块区域的值。 变量的命名 变量有字母,下划线和数字组成 不能以数...
分类:编程语言   时间:2015-07-19 00:14:34    阅读次数:176
Java数据结构-线性表之顺序表ArrayList
线性表的顺序存储结构,也称为顺序表,指用一段连续的存储单元依次存储线性表中的数据元素。根据顺序表的特性,我们用数组来实现顺序表,下面是我通过数组实现的Java版本的顺序表。package com.phn.datestructure; /** * @author 潘海南 * @Email 1016593477@qq.com * @TODO 顺序表 * @date 2015年7月16日 */...
分类:编程语言   时间:2015-07-19 00:14:59    阅读次数:183
Java 异常及异常处理
1、什么是异常   简单来说,就是由于程序运行是出现的问题,但是可以通过try…和catch捕获处理,之后程序继续运行。   在java中,分异常(Exception)和错误(error)两种。其中“异常”是程序编写不完善(或者由于外部原因,网络错误,文件错误等)引起的;而“错误”虚拟机本身故障(如OutOfMemoryError),一旦出现错误,我们将不能处理,程序将无法继续执行。2、异常处理...
分类:编程语言   时间:2015-07-19 00:15:23    阅读次数:195
Java数据结构-线性表之单链表LinkedList
线性表的链式存储结构,也称之为链式表,链表;链表的存储单元可以连续也可以不连续。 链表中的节点包含数据域和指针域,数据域为存储数据元素信息的域,指针域为存储直接后继位置(一般称为指针)的域。注意一个头结点和头指针的区别: 头指针: 指向链表的第一个节点的指针,若链表有头结点,则是指向头结点的指针; 头指针具有标识作用,所以常用头指针作为链表的名字; 不论链表是否为空,头指针都不为空; 是链表的必...
分类:编程语言   时间:2015-07-19 00:14:40    阅读次数:196
C语言的内存管理分析 栈区 代码区 堆区 静态区 常量区
系统为了管理内存 把内存划分了几个区域      1> 栈区      栈区之中的数据在栈区之中以栈的形式进行存储.      栈区的特点:数据是先进后出,      放在栈区里面存放的是局部变量.(例如定义在函数内部的变量)      栈区之中的数据(局部变量)的作用范围过了之后,系统就会回收自动管理栈区的内存(分配内存 , 回收内存),不需要开发人员来手动管理 ...
分类:编程语言   时间:2015-07-19 00:11:54    阅读次数:1825
题目1196:成绩排序
题目描述: 用一维数组存储学号和成绩,然后,按成绩排序输出。 输入: 输入第一行包括一个整数N(1 接下来的N行每行包括两个整数p和q,分别代表每个学生的学号和成绩。 输出: 按照学生的成绩从小到大进行排序,并将排序后的学生信息打印出来。 如果学生的成绩相同,则按照学号的大小进行从小到大排序。 样例输入: 3 1 90 2 87 3 92 样例输出: ...
分类:编程语言   时间:2015-07-19 00:12:18    阅读次数:185
初探Java多线程
java多线程创建两种方法。 currentThread()方法、sleep()方法、getId()方法 简单讲解...
分类:编程语言   时间:2015-07-19 00:10:37    阅读次数:175
C++ Primer快速入门之五:实用的模板库
更新:重新排版代码格式 除上篇博客介绍的基本数据类型外,C++ 还定义了一个内容丰富的抽象数据类 型标准库。包括 string 和 vector,它们分别定义了字符串和矢量(集合)。string 和 vector 往往用迭代器iterator访问 string 中的字符,或者 vector 中的元素。       另一种标准库类型 bitset,她提供了一些方法的集合,我们可以利用...
分类:编程语言   时间:2015-07-19 00:11:26    阅读次数:182
python模块 - collections模块
http://blog.csdn.net/pipisorry/article/details/46947833 集合库collection collections模块介绍 Python拥有一些内置的数据类型,比如str, int, list, tuple, dict等, collections模块在这些内置数据类型的基础上,提供了几个额外的数据类型: 1.namedtupl...
分类:编程语言   时间:2015-07-19 00:09:43    阅读次数:218
GCD多线程的使用(二)
记录一下GCD的几个重要API的用法。
分类:编程语言   时间:2015-07-19 00:07:53    阅读次数:171
python 八皇后
def eight_queen(): def if_inline(point1, point2): if(point1[0] == point2[0] or\ abs(point1[0] - point2[0]) == abs(point1[1] - poi...
分类:编程语言   时间:2015-07-19 00:09:17    阅读次数:268
SpringContextHolder 静态持有SpringContext的引用
import java.util.Map;import org.springframework.context.ApplicationContext;import org.springframework.context.ApplicationContextAware;/** * *以静态变量保存Sp...
分类:编程语言   时间:2015-07-19 00:06:52    阅读次数:441
SWIFT中调用Segue的几个方法
场景1:如图所示,在视图的第一个按钮处拉出一条Segue到另外一个视图,并给这个Segue命名,如SegueOne此时可以用代码调用这个Segue切换视图:self.performSegueWithIdentifier("SegueOne", sender: nil)场景2:有时候有时候,TablV...
分类:编程语言   时间:2015-07-19 00:05:46    阅读次数:245
转:java读取配置文件的几种方法
转自: http://www.iteye.com/topic/56496 在现实工作中,我们常常需要保存一些系统配置信息,大家一般都会选择配置文件来完成,本文根据笔者工作中用到的读取配置文件的方法小小总结一下,主要叙述的是spring读取配置文件的方法。 一.读取xml配置文件 (一)新建一个jav...
分类:编程语言   时间:2015-07-19 00:03:24    阅读次数:168
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!